The Timeless Significance of Etiquette
Introduction In an ever-evolving world, the value of etiquette remains steadfast. While some argue it’s a relic of the past, the truth is, the principles of good behavior and manners are timeless. As culture and customs evolve, so do the guidelines of politeness, ensuring that society functions harmoniously. The absence of etiquette can lead to chaos, misunderstandings, and conflicts, ranging from minor disagreements to aggressive confrontations.
Defining Etiquette Etiquette acts as a framework governing our interactions, whether they're social, business-related, or personal. Rooted in our cultural norms and ethical values, etiquette serves as a mirror reflecting our collective consciousness. Without it, societal interactions could devolve into a survival-of-the-fittest scenario, where compassion and understanding are secondary to individual ambitions.
Historically, etiquette played a significant role in defining and reinforcing societal hierarchies. For instance, during the Middle Ages, etiquette determined how much a lower-ranking person should bow to a superior or the expected mourning practices after a family member's passing. Such traditions were largely influenced by the elite classes, using them to cement their roles and authority within society. However, over time, as societies became more inclusive, the principles of etiquette transformed into a universal guide, promoting mutual respect and understanding rather than rigid class structures.
Etiquette in Modern Times In today’s fast-paced world, the essence of etiquette lies in:
-
Personal Comfort: By understanding and applying etiquette, individuals navigate social situations more confidently.
-
Empathy: Etiquette ensures the emotions and feelings of others are prioritized, preventing unintended slights or offenses.
-
Clear Communication: Effective etiquette breaks barriers, fostering open and honest dialogue.
-
Professionalism: In the workplace, etiquette can elevate one’s perceived competence and professionalism.
-
First Impressions: Those crucial initial moments of interaction can set the tone for future engagements. Proper etiquette ensures these moments are positive.
While societal norms are constantly shifting, etiquette remains the compass that directs us toward considerate behavior. Its guidelines, while adaptive, always emphasize fairness, politeness, and consideration.
